Exploring the Sculptural Vision of Bülent Çınar

Bülent Çınar’s artistic journey began in Denizli, Turkey, a region steeped in ancient history and geological formations that undoubtedly instilled an early appreciation for form and texture. Born in 1971, Çınar pursued his passion for sculpture with unwavering dedication, culminating in his current role as Associate Professor at Mimar Sinan Fine Arts University in Istanbul – a position reflecting not only academic accomplishment but also a commitment to nurturing the next generation of sculptors. His artistic practice is characterized by an exploration of innovative sculptural forms and conceptual themes that grapple with questions of materiality and perception. Çınar’s involvement in over ten international sculpture symposiums demonstrates his collaborative spirit and willingness to engage with diverse perspectives within the art world. These experiences have fueled his creative growth and solidified his reputation as a respected figure amongst fellow artists. Çınar's sculptural works often utilize metal – particularly stainless steel – as their primary medium, reflecting a fascination with industrial processes and challenging conventional notions of beauty. The meticulous craftsmanship involved in transforming raw materials into evocative shapes speaks to a profound understanding of artistic technique and a desire to push boundaries. His sculptures aren’t merely objects; they are dialogues between form and space, inviting viewers to contemplate the relationship between human experience and the natural world. Examining Çınar's oeuvre reveals influences from Minimalism and Conceptual Art, movements that prioritize simplicity and intellectual engagement over decorative embellishment. However, his work transcends these stylistic categories, retaining a distinctly Turkish sensibility rooted in tradition while simultaneously embracing contemporary artistic concerns. This duality underscores Çınar’s ability to synthesize disparate ideas into cohesive visual statements. Major achievements include numerous solo exhibitions showcasing his distinctive sculptural style, as well as participation in prominent national and international exhibitions that have garnered critical acclaim. His work has been recognized for its conceptual depth and technical prowess, establishing him as a significant contributor to the landscape of Turkish contemporary art. Bülent Çınar continues to inspire artists and scholars alike with his unwavering pursuit of artistic excellence and his commitment to fostering dialogue about art’s role in shaping our understanding of the world.
